Compensation of the Disbursement Agent. On February 17, 2013 and then on the 17th day of each April, June, August, October, December and February until such time as the Final Completion Date (as the same may be extended in accordance with this Agreement) shall have occurred, Borrower shall pay, or cause to be paid the fees and any other amounts scheduled to be paid under the Agency Fee Letter, which amount shall constitute compensation for services to be performed by the Disbursement Agent for the immediately succeeding two (2) month period commencing on the 17th day of the calendar month in which such payment is due. Upon the request of the Borrower (unless an Event of Default has occurred and is continuing) the Disbursement Agent shall instruct the securities intermediary or account bank to transfer such fees and any other amounts scheduled to be paid under the Agency Fee Letter from the Company Funds Account directly to the Disbursement Agent.
